Current Role at Telltale Games
Zac Litton serves as the Chief Technology Officer at Telltale Games, a position he has held since 2019. In this role, he focuses on developing a modern cross-platform development pipeline, enhancing the company's technological capabilities. He is currently involved in ramping up a talented team for the sequel of 'The Wolf Among Us', contributing to the evolution of interactive storytelling.
Previous Experience at Telltale Games
Prior to his current role, Zac Litton worked at Telltale Games in various capacities. He served as Technical Director from 2010 to 2012, and later as Vice President of Engineering from 2013 to 2018. During his tenure, he collaborated with a team of industry veterans to innovate in interactive storytelling, significantly impacting the company's development processes.
Professional Background
Zac Litton has a diverse professional background in the gaming industry. He founded Fastbreak Studios Inc and served as President from 2009 to 2012. He also worked as Lead Engineer at Kuju America for four months in 2008 and held the same position at Pronto Games Inc from 2002 to 2008. Additionally, he was the CTO at Endless Entertainment from 2018 to 2019.
Education and Qualifications
Zac Litton studied Computer Engineering at the University of Miami, where he earned a Bachelor of Science degree from 1997 to 2001. He also attended Killian High School, laying the foundation for his future career in technology and engineering within the gaming industry.
